Regarding : PVS - QRC RUN FAILURE

narendra046
narendra046 over 11 years ago

 HI All,

 Newly I made PVS drc & lvs and QRC setup for new technology(gf28nm).

 PVS version - Version        : 12.1.1-p076

 QRC Version        : 10.1.0-s231

 

When I'm running PVS - QRC through QRC menu, It was failed and showing error like..,

All device symbols for the extracted view are present.

INFO (LBRCXU-114): Finished /chicago/tools/cadence/IC6150/bin/qrcToDfII

INFO (LBRCXM-642): Constructing the RCX run script

INFO (RCXSPIC-28057): RCXspice: unrecognized variable 'CFITABLE' in file '/remote2/test_proj/analog_project/gf28hp/release/qrc/5U1x_1T8x_LB/nominal/RCXspiceINIT'

ERROR (LBRCXM-644): Bad return status from RCX script generator. 0x100

INFO (LBRCXM-709): *****  QRC terminated abnormally  *****

    Hi Narendra

    It means that your current version of QRC is older compared to the version which Globalfoundries had used to prepared the QRC package. The problem can be easily resolved by switching to a newer version of QRC (e.g. QRC14.1).
